Dennis Shaw is a musician, marathoner (Boston!), retired military officer, math modeler, muse, and United Methodist Pastor. A keen observer of the human condition, he has degrees in music, quantitative methods (don’t ask!), theology and leadership. He will discuss with other leaders how to become engaged and present in our current leadership opportunities. Critical to leadership is strong self-awareness. Becoming authentic, empathetic, and aware will form the framework of all discussions. You can access and follow this podcast on Apple, Podbean, Spotify and Amazon Music.

Exodus 3: 1-15 -- Called by God
Monday Oct 05, 2015
Monday Oct 05, 2015
This is a little from both 9 and 10:30. The scripture reading and introduction is from 9 and the actual sermon is from 10:30. Moses is called by God. He key is the issue of "po" (here) and "hineni" (here I am but with a spiritual commitment.) Probably need to listen close to the sermon but when getting ready to exit a USAF aircraft, while still in flight, the commitment is made by a statement of "All OK". In. 100% in and ready.
